
Cape Byron Kayaks
Enjoy paddling your sea kayak out through the surf and later ride some of Australia’s most famous Byron Bay waves with Cape Byron Kayaks – Byron Bay’s original dolphin kayaking experience established in 1995.
Get up close and personal with our friendly bottlenose dolphins and discover how inquisitive they can be. Spot sea turtles as they come up for a breath of air. From May to November, you can also marvel at the size of the majestic humpback whales as they migrate through Australia’s beautiful Byron Bay.
Following this incredible experience with nature, complete your tour with all you can eat Tim Tams !
Cape Byron Kayaks offer a wildlife guarantee: If we don’t see dolphins or whales (during whale season) you can come again for free.
Our guides are kayakers, surfers, self-proclaimed local historians, and excellent watermen. They know Byron Bay well and are the best guides in the business. With that in mind, you can relax and be guided around Byron Bay in our two people, sit-on-top-style sea kayaks, that are designed for ease of operation and stability. No prior experience is necessary. Your safety and enjoyment are our priorities. We supply all safety gear: Lifejackets, helmets, and wetsuits (if necessary).
To maintain a competitive price point rather than increasing prices we now have one price for all participants – $89pp
Tour duration: Approx 2.5 hours
